Catfish Win Series

Rome, GA – The Columbus Catfish defeated the Rome Braves (5-2) Sunday afternoon at State Mutual Stadium in front of 2,436 fans.

Columbus scored in the first inning after Maiko Loyola singled, stole second and later scored on a Chase Fontaine single for the 1-0 score. In the second, Rome took the lead after Freddie Freeman doubled and Michael Fisher singled. Yohan Silva then doubled to score Freeman tying the game. Samuel Sime then hit a sacrifice fly to score Fisher giving Rome the 2-1 advantage.

In the eighth inning, the Catfish tied the game 2-2 on a Chase Fontaine RBI single. Columbus took the lead in the ninth scoring three runs highlighted by RBI singles by Ian Paxton and Shawn Williams making the score and the final 5-2.

Glen Gibson gets the win (2-8) for Columbus while Yelier Castro gets the loss (0-3). Justin Garcia earns the save, his first of the season.
